Wow there is a lot of good stuff here guys. I am really impressed with those images. Now we are into painting remember to work big to small. Start with the big forms and move down, also use the largest brush possible. Big brush, big forms. All of the little lines and details actually hurt the image if the tones aren't correct so it is a little scary but using a big fat brush without opacity is helpful in blocking in.
